2,6-dibromo-4-[(E)-2-nitroethenyl]phenol, also known as bromonitrophenol, is a synthetic organic compound characterized by its pale yellow to light brown crystalline solid appearance. It possesses the molecular formula C8H5Br2NO4 and is soluble in organic solvents such as ethanol and acetone. This versatile compound is known for its ability to participate in a range of chemical reactions, including halogenation, nitration, and reduction, which makes it a valuable intermediate in organic chemistry.

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 1988-44-9 includes 7 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 4 digits, 1,9,8 and 8 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 4 and 4 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 1988-44:
(6*1)+(5*9)+(4*8)+(3*8)+(2*4)+(1*4)=119
119 % 10 = 9
So 1988-44-9 is a valid CAS Registry Number.
